    Collecting your child from the Chabad Youth OSHC premises

    We recommend all children are to be picked up by a Parent or an Authorised Nominee directly from the Chabad Youth OSHC premises. An Authorised Nominee means a person who has been given permission by a parent or family member to collect the child from the education and care service.

    If you would like for your child to walk home by themselves, or to a location to be picked up, in accordance with Regulation 99(4)(b), they will need to be signed out by a Chabad Youth OSHC staff member and/or volunteer before exiting the premises.

  • Excursion Information:

    Mode of transport for all excursions: Charter bus. All buses are fitted with seat belts.

    Educator ratio for all excursions will be at least 1:15.

    28 September – Timezone & Zone Bowling Southland (Westfield, Level 3/1239 Nepean Hwy, Cheltenham VIC 3192) each way 15 minutes, off-site time 2.5 hours. Activity: Campers will have the opportunity to participate in ten-pin bowling and arcade games. Expected number of participants: 45 campers, 3 staff, 6 volunteers.

    29 September – Gravity Zone (25 Oliphant Way, Seaford VIC 3198) each way 40 minutes, off-site time 3 hours 10 minutes. Activity: Campers will have the opportunity to participate in trampolining activities. Expected number of participants: 45 campers, 3 staff, 6 volunteers.

    30 September – Nerf Wars and Awesome STEM Crafts (Incursion) Activity: Campers will have the opportunity to participate in a Nerf Wars experience and hands-on STEM craft activities at the service. Expected number of participants: 45 campers, 3 staff, 6 volunteers.

    1 October – Royal Melbourne Show (Epsom Rd, Ascot Vale VIC 3032) each way 30 minutes, off-site time 5 hours. Activity: Campers will have the opportunity to participate in a variety of educational, agricultural, cultural and recreational activities throughout the Royal Melbourne Show. Expected number of participants: 45 campers, 3 staff, 6 volunteers.

    Reason for excursions: Excursions during vacation care provide children with opportunities to develop an understanding of belonging to groups and communities and to learn to interact with others with care, empathy and respect. Excursions create engaging learning environments that encourage physical activity, social development and the exploration of new experiences.

    Transportation details (to and from): The most convenient and safest route, as determined by the bus driver at the time. Children attending excursions will travel by private charter bus. A Google Maps route is available in the relevant risk assessments.

    Staff-to-child ratio: Up to 45 children with 3 staff and 6 volunteers.
